MikeMan 01-16-2005, 01:42 AM I can't quite see why the clutch would feel firmer when the engine's off though. The whole clutch hydraulic line isn't connected to the engine in any way. Sounds like it could be a problem with the throw out bearing or something. You probably wont have to buy a new clutch plate, so don't worry about your investment of the new clutch. Try undoing the slave cylinder and get a mate to depress the clutch pedal. Check to see if it moves the slave piston in and out. If not, then theres probably a problem with the slave or master cylinder. If it does move, then you're looking at a new clutch system. -Mike Hodo 01-16-2005, 03:13 AM mike man is pretty much on it there. But..... On the up side it could be as simple as air or water in your clutch lines. In that case a good bleeding and flush should help.
